Arson investigators were sent to a public housing building in the Central-Alameda area of Los Angeles Sunday following a fire that was quickly knocked down, authorities said.
Firefighters dispatched at 9:06 a.m. Sunday to 5337 S. Duarte St., a few blocks west of Alameda Street, had the fire out at 9:17 a.m., the Los Angeles Fire Department reported.
No injuries were reported, and the cause of the fire was under investigation.
Investigators were dispatched to the two-story building for suspected arson, the LAFD said.
